Jack Cecil Goodwin, 86, of Ashland, passed away Tuesday, April 18, 2017, at the Community Hospice Care Center.

He was born September 10, 1930, in Ashland, to the late Cecil and Helen Hatcher Goodwin. He was also preceded in death by his loving wife, Betty Boggess Goodwin in 2000; brother, Homer Goodwin; and two sisters, Linda Miller and Jo Ann Carhart.

Jack was a member of Pollard Baptist Church and retired from the Ashland Fire Department after 20 years of service. He was a member of Elks Lodge B.P.O.E. 350, American Legion Post 76, and Kentucky Bikers Association. He served honorably in the United States Army during the Korean War.

Survivors include two daughters, Cheryl Goodwin of Morehead, and Cindy Wesley and husband, Robert of Ashland, and; two grandchildren, Robert Wesley, III, and Katie Wesley both of Ashland; and a host of loving extended family members and friends.
